Assessing the Situation

Before any work begins, a thorough assessment is crucial. Roofing contractors in Wheat Ridge typically start by evaluating the current roof’s condition, the solar panels’ placement, and the overall layout. This involves inspecting the panels for any wear, checking the wiring and mounting systems, and determining how much of the roof needs replacement. Solar panels, often mounted on racks above the roof surface, can complicate access to certain areas. Professionals use tools like drones or ladders to map out the site without disturbing the panels. In Wheat Ridge, where homes may have varied roof pitches due to the Front Range terrain, this step ensures safety and precision. Homeowners should coordinate with certified solar technicians early to review warranties and potential impacts on energy production.

Transition planning also considers the panels’ proximity to the work zone. If the new roofing is directly adjacent, measures must prevent debris from falling onto the panels or vibrations from loosening mounts. Local building codes in Jefferson County, which includes Wheat Ridge, require permits that account for solar integrations, emphasizing structural integrity. This initial phase sets the foundation for a disruption-free installation, typically lasting a few days to a week depending on roof size.

Protecting Existing Solar Panels

Protection is paramount to avoid damage during installation. Contractors employ several strategies to safeguard solar panels. One common method is erecting temporary barriers or tarps around the panels to shield them from falling shingles, tools, or weather exposure. In Wheat Ridge’s variable climate, where sudden snow or rain can occur, these covers are secured with weather-resistant materials. Ground crews position safety nets below the panels to catch any dislodged debris, minimizing risks to the photovoltaic cells, which are sensitive to impacts.

Additionally, access paths are carefully planned to steer clear of panel areas. Workers use scaffolding or harnesses for elevated work on the new roof section, avoiding direct contact with solar infrastructure. Electrical safety is another focus; panels remain connected to the grid unless absolutely necessary, but shutoffs are managed by licensed electricians to comply with National Electrical Code standards. In Wheat Ridge, where many homes tie into Xcel Energy’s grid, this coordination prevents outages. By prioritizing these protections, the transition maintains solar output, often with only minor interruptions measured in hours rather than days.

Coordinating with Solar Professionals

Seamless transitions rely on collaboration between roofing and solar experts. Homeowners in Wheat Ridge often hire integrated teams from local companies like those affiliated with the Colorado Roofing Contractors Association. The solar installer reviews the project plan, advising on temporary disconnections if panels must be moved slightly for access. This is rare but may occur if the new roof extends under panel edges. During coordination, the team assesses inverter locations and battery storage, ensuring they remain operational.

Communication is key; regular updates via apps or site meetings keep everyone aligned. For instance, roofing work might pause during peak sunlight hours to maximize energy generation. In Wheat Ridge’s residential neighborhoods, noise and dust controls are also discussed to respect neighbors. This partnership not only streamlines the process but also preserves solar warranties, which could be voided by unauthorized handling. Ultimately, such coordination turns a potential headache into an efficient upgrade.

Handling the Physical Transition

The core of the transition involves meticulous execution on the roof. Workers start by removing old materials from the non-solar section, using vacuums to control dust that could settle on panels. As the new underlayment and shingles are installed, flashing and seals are applied at the boundary to prevent leaks where old and new roofs meet. In Wheat Ridge, where asphalt shingles dominate due to hail risks, matching materials ensures a uniform appearance and longevity.

If panels overhang the transition area, specialized clips or extensions secure the new roof edge without compromising mounts. Ventilation is maintained to avoid heat buildup under panels, a common concern in Colorado’s high-altitude sun. The process typically wraps up with a final inspection, testing for water tightness and structural stability. This hands-on approach, guided by experienced crews, minimizes downtime—often restoring full functionality within 24-48 hours post-installation.

Costs and Benefits of the Transition

While adding complexity, handling a roof transition near solar panels offers long-term value. Costs in Wheat Ridge range from $10,000 to $25,000 for a standard roof, with solar protections adding 10-20% due to specialized labor. However, avoiding panel damage saves thousands in replacements. Benefits include enhanced energy efficiency; a new roof can boost solar output by 5-10% through better insulation. Increased home value is another perk, with solar-roof combos appealing to eco-conscious buyers in the Denver metro.

Insurance considerations are vital—many policies cover installation mishaps, but documenting the process protects claims. Over time, the investment pays off through reduced utility bills and durability against local weather extremes. Frequently Asked Questions

1. Do solar panels need to be removed during a new roof installation next to them? Typically, no. Panels are protected in place, but temporary relocation may be needed if they directly obstruct the work area. Consult your solar provider for specifics.

2. How long does the transition process take in Wheat Ridge? It varies by roof size but usually spans 1-5 days, with solar disruptions limited to a few hours. Weather can extend timelines.

3. What permits are required for such installations in Wheat Ridge? You’ll need a building permit from the city’s department, including solar impact details. Roofing and electrical permits may also apply.

4. Can the new roof affect my solar panel warranty? Not if handled by certified professionals. Ensure contractors coordinate with your solar company to maintain coverage.

5. How is electrical safety managed during the transition? Licensed electricians handle any shutoffs, following NEC guidelines. Panels often stay connected to minimize outages.

6. Are there incentives for solar-compatible roofing in Wheat Ridge? Yes, Colorado offers tax credits and rebates. Check with the state’s energy office for eligibility.

7. What materials are best for roofs near solar panels? Durable options like impact-resistant asphalt shingles suit Wheat Ridge’s hail-prone weather and pair well with solar mounts.
